Install additional tools:
```bash
# install MSPC --- consensus peak
wget --quiet https://github.com/Genometric/MSPC/releases/latest/download/linux-x64.zip -O MSPC_linux_x64.zip && unzip -q MSPC_linux_x64.zip -d mspc && cd mspc && chmod +x mspc

# install meme --- motif anaysis
## install from source
cd /opt && wget --quiet https://meme-suite.org/meme/meme-software/5.5.5/meme-5.5.5.tar.gz -O meme-5.5.5.tar.gz && tar -zxf meme-5.5.5.tar.gz && cd meme-5.5.5 && ./configure --prefix=`pwd`/meme-5.5.5/meme --enable-build-libxml2 --enable-build-libxslt && make && make install
## install from conda: conda install -c bioconda meme

# install homer --- motif enrichment
## install from source
mkdir homer && cd homer && wget --quiet http://homer.ucsd.edu/homer/configureHomer.pl -O configureHomer.pl && chmod +x configureHomer.pl && perl configureHomer.pl -install
## install from conda: conda install -c bioconda homer
## Downloading Homer Packages: http://homer.ucsd.edu/homer/introduction/install.html

# install deeptools and bart
pip install deeptools numpy pandas scipy tables scikit-learn matplotlib
wget --quiet https://virginia.box.com/shared/static/031noe820hk888qzcxvw1cazol1gdhi0.gz -O bart_v2.0.tar.gz && tar -zxf bart_v2.0.tar.gz
## Download the resources and setup the configuration file
## https://zanglab.github.io/bart/index.htm#install
```

### Docker
We also provide a [docker image](https://hub.docker.com/repository/docker/soyabean/debpeak) to use:

```bash
# pull the image
dock pull soyabean/debpeak:1.6

# run the image
docker run --rm -p 8888:8787 -e PASSWORD=passwd -e ROOT=TRUE -it debpeak:1.6
```

**Notes**:

* After running the above codes, open browser and enter `http://localhost:8888/`, the user name is `rstudio`, the password is `passwd` (set by `-e PASSWORD=passwd`)
* If port `8888` is in use, change `-p 8888:8787`
* The `meme suit` path: `/opt/meme-5.5.5/meme/bin`.
* The `homer suit` path: `/opt/homer/bin`.
* The `configureHomer.pl` path: `/opt/homer`.
* The `bart` path: `/opt/bart_v2.0/bin`
* You still need to **download the resources and setup the configuration file for [bart](https://zanglab.github.io/bart/index.htm#install)** and **download species packages for [homer](http://homer.ucsd.edu/homer/introduction/install.html)**.
